OAKLAND, Calif. _ What do you do if you're a point guard with two unselfish forwards?

If you're Chauncey Billups, you keep feeding them the ball.

"Those two guys are so unselfish that there are times that we just have to keep going through them, especially Tayshaun," said Billups, the Pistons' second-leading scorer.
